发明名称 OPTICAL SIGNAL RECEIVING MODULE
摘要 PROBLEM TO BE SOLVED: To reduce parts and processes and to easily perform optical axis adjustment by adding an airtight sealing function to a prism and fixing a lens to the outside of an airtight space of a case inside. SOLUTION: In an optical signal receiving module arranged so that their positional relation between an optical fiber 1 and a photodetector 8 is that the central axis of the optical fiber 1 is orthogonally intersected with a perpendicular from the light receiving surface center of the photodetector 8, a prism 9 is a triangular pillar for connecting an optical signal converged by the lens 7 to the light receiving surface of the photodetector 8, and a total reflection film is vapor deposited on a side surface 17 except a light incident surface from the lens 7 and a light outgoing surface to the photodetector 8 among three pillar side surfaces. Input/output terminals and a case 4 with an optical signal passing hole fix directly or indirectly the photodetector 8. A cover 6 airtight seals the inside of the case 4. The prism 9 is airtight fixed to the optical signal passing hold, and the airtight sealing function is added to the prism 9, and the lens 7 is fixed to the outside of the airtight space in the case 4 inside.
